Born in 1977 in Budapest, Hungary.
Graduated from the Moholy-Nagy University of Art and Design, Budapest, in 2004.
Lives and works in Linz.
„The central idea that preoccupies me intensely is the expansion of traditional, two-dimensional oil painting, which already has a long tradition. In my works, I explore the contrast between softness and hardness, as well as flatness and plasticity. The works of the last decade are described using the term 'soft tension', as this best reflects the tactile aspects and characteristic features of their technical creation. I create three-dimensional objects that appear solid and hard by using and tensing soft and flat materials. The resulting forms clearly represent imprints of the working process, as well as the laws and peculiarities of the materials used“.
